Difference Between Insulation And Cladding. Typically, exterior cladding acts as a ‘skin’ for your home that covers up your insulation. Insulated facade cladding reduces a building’s heating and cooling loads, protects the environment, saves money, and makes your building more comfortable. Exterior cladding, wall cladding, or wall siding refers to the material that goes on the outside of your home. Cladding refers to a material applied over another for protection or aesthetics, while lagging is insulation, often around pipes or boilers, to conserve heat.
